  3. Bullets out has been gaining popularity lately because it tends to be more consistent as you reach further and further back past 9 o'clock. This can vary greatly, though, based on body shape, for example. In Limited and Open, it's easier for many to put the mags at an angle, like thermobollocks said, When you sweep your hand down toward your belt, the mag is in the perfect orientation. And as you sweep your arm back toward 9 o'clock, all your mags are at the same angle, relative to your arm. It may look and seem strange, but it works.

  17. I built a ASA side charge upper a while back and I didn't care for it. The main reason was because it didn't have a forward assist and the charging handle is non-reciprocating so you can't use that. I like to have a forward assist, whether it be for easing a round into the chamber on a hunting rifle or making sure the bolt is in battery after checking to make sure a round is in the chamber on a competition rifle. I can certainly see the benefit of a side charger on a rifle with a large scope, but I would stay away from ASA.
